Daily Dive Tour |
This tour offers to discover the sea beauties in the Galapagos Islands. This is a one day tour, which is made in speedboats with all the safety and comfort required for passenger to their adventure.
Daily Dive Tour begins early in the morning from Puerto Ayora, we pick the passengers up from their hotel and transfer them to the fast launch. There are two meet points to reach the launch, it depends on our destination.
Dive master in Galapagos can guide maximum 6 people, before each immersion you will be instructed by your guide. Underwater you will always be in contact with your group and the guide. You will have snacks after each dive and at noon a lunch will be served.
From this once in a life experience you will have an underwater photo or a short video of you adventure in the Galapagos Islands.

DISCOVER SCUBA DIVING
Learn to dive in one day!!
If you don't have enough time to join the Open Water Diver Course or if you just want to try diving first before you enroll on a diving course, this program will be the right choice. Your scuba instructor will spend a little time with you to explain the basic principles of scuba diving and give you an overview of your scuba gear, which is supplied by the dive shop. Once you feel comfortable, your instructor will take you in the beach to help you learn basic scuba skills. Then, if you like, you can go with your instructor for a short discovery dive up to 40 feet/ 12 meters. Most Discover Scuba Diving experiences about an hour or two.
PREREQUISITES: Be 10 years or older, Parent or guardian signature required for new divers younger than legal age.
INCLUDING: dives + all equipment + theory lessons + boat trips.
OPEN WATER DIVER
Get your PADI scuba certification.
If you’ve always wanted to learn how to scuba dive, discover new adventures or simply see the wondrous world beneath the waves, this is where it starts. The PADI Open Water Diver course is the world’s most popular scuba course, and has introduced millions of people to the adventurous diving lifestyle.
PREREQUISITES: Minimum age 15 (10 for Junior Divers), One color picture, passport size.
INCLUDING: 4 dives + all equipment + theory lessons + pool sessions + boat trips + reference material and PADI certification.

RESCUE DIVER
“Challenging” and “rewarding” best describe the PADI Rescue Diver course.
Building upon what you’ve already learned, this course expands on what you already know about how to prevent problems, and how to manage them if they occur. The fun part about this course is rising to challenges and mastering them. Most divers find this course both demanding and rewarding, and at the end, say it’s the best course they’ve ever taken.
PREREQUISITES: Minimum age 15 (12 for Junior Divers), One color picture, passport size, the student must be certified as a PADI Advanced Open Water Diver or have a qualifying certification from another training organization, with proof of 20 or more logged dives documenting experience in deep diving and underwater navigation.
INCLUDING: 4 dives + All equipment + theory lessons, + boat trips + reference material and PADI certification.

DIVE MASTER
Looking for the first step in working with scuba as a career?
Your adventure into the professional levels of recreational scuba diving begins with the PADI Divemaster program. Working closely with a PADI Instructor, in this program you expand your dive knowledge and hone your skills to the professional level. PADI Divemaster training develops your leadership abilities, qualifying you to supervise dive activities and assist instructors with student divers. PADI Divemaster is the prerequisite certification for both the PADI Assistant Instructor and PADI Open Water Scuba Instructor certifications.
PREREQUISITES: Age minimum 18 years, to be certified as OWD, RESCUE. EFR, in the last 24 months, 60 certified immersions, color photo size passport.
INCLUDING: All equipment + theory lessons + boat trips + Manual + Practical
NOT INCLUDING: Membership PADI
